Chelovek Dela - Kuban Revives Entrepreneurship in Krasnodar
The fourth edition of the revived 'Chelovek Dela - Kuban' project was recently presented in the Krasnodar region. The event, which has a 20-year history in the country, aims to foster entrepreneurship and create a platform for experience exchange, while also developing business journalism in the region.
The project, published by Ivan Petrov, seeks to inspire initiatives and create a business environment. The evening programme included guest performances and product presentations. Viktor Anisimov, director of the Kuban Scientific Fund, expressed interest in collaborating with the journal's platforms. Elena Retinskikh, the chief editor and publisher, emphasised the importance of discussing people's values and plans.
